What Colors Go with Gracious Greige?

Published in Neutral Color Palettes 4 mins read

Gracious Greige, a sophisticated and versatile blend of warm gray and subtle beige, pairs beautifully with a wide array of colors, from grounding neutrals to vibrant accents, creating a timeless and elegant aesthetic. Its inherently warm gray nature makes it an ideal backdrop for diverse design schemes.

Understanding Gracious Greige

As a classic neutral and warm gray paint color, Gracious Greige offers incredible longevity and adaptability, making it a beloved choice year after year. It provides a comforting yet refined foundation, allowing other colors and textures to truly shine. Its warmth ensures it never feels cold, while its gray undertone keeps it contemporary and chic.

Core Neutral Pairings for a Balanced Look

To truly bring out the best in Gracious Greige, consider these foundational neutral pairings:

  • Black and Dark Furniture: To enhance its inherent warmth and create a striking contrast, incorporate black or dark furniture pieces. Think deep espresso coffee tables, charcoal console tables, or ebony dining chairs. These dark elements ground the space and add a touch of modern sophistication, making the greige appear even richer.
  • White and Light Cream Textiles: To balance the deeper tones and introduce an airy, fresh feel, integrate light cream or crisp white textile pieces. This includes sofas, throw pillows, area rugs, and window treatments. These lighter hues "even out" the palette, providing visual relief and a sense of openness.
  • Other Neutrals:
    • Taupe: Blends seamlessly, creating a harmonious and layered neutral scheme.
    • Warm Gray: Different shades of warm gray can add depth without introducing new colors, maintaining a sophisticated monochrome feel.
    • Muted Beige: Emphasizes the beige undertones of greige, contributing to a cozy and inviting atmosphere.

Adding Color and Depth

Gracious Greige acts as an excellent canvas for various accent colors, allowing you to tailor the mood of your space.

Soothing Cool Tones

Cool colors provide a serene contrast and can elevate the sophistication of a greige room.

  • Dusty Blues: Soft, muted blues like sky blue or dusty periwinkle create a calming and tranquil environment. They work wonderfully in bedrooms and living areas.
  • Deep Navy: For a bolder, more traditional look, deep navy adds an anchor of color that feels both classic and luxurious against greige.

  • Emerald Green: A jewel-toned emerald can introduce a lavish and dramatic flair, especially in velvet upholstery or decorative accents.

Inviting Warm Tones

To amplify the warmth of Gracious Greige, consider incorporating rich, earthy, or spicy hues.

  • Terracotta and Rust: These warm, grounded oranges and reds add a cozy, inviting feel, reminiscent of Mediterranean or desert landscapes. They're perfect for accents in throws, pottery, or small decorative items.
  • Muted Golds and Mustards: These cheerful yet sophisticated yellows inject warmth and a subtle richness without being overpowering. They pair beautifully with greige to create an inviting, sun-kissed atmosphere.
  • Rich Browns: Beyond dark furniture, incorporating deep chocolate or caramel browns in textures like leather or wood can enhance the cozy, classic feel.

Metallic Accents for Shine and Sophistication

Metallics add an extra layer of elegance and sparkle to a greige scheme.

  • Gold and Brass: These warm metallics complement the greige's warmth, adding a touch of luxury and vintage charm. Use them in light fixtures, hardware, or decorative objects.
  • Brushed Nickel and Matte Black: For a more contemporary or industrial feel, brushed nickel offers a subtle coolness, while matte black provides a crisp, modern edge in hardware, frames, or fixtures.

Practical Application Tips

  • Layer Textures: Combine smooth, rough, soft, and hard textures (e.g., velvet, linen, wood, metal) to add visual interest and depth to your greige space.
  • Consider Lighting: The undertones of greige can shift under different lighting conditions. Always test paint swatches in your space to see how natural and artificial light affects its appearance throughout the day.
  • Mix Warm and Cool: Don't be afraid to combine warm and cool accent colors. For instance, a greige wall with a navy sofa can be beautifully accented with a mustard throw pillow and brass decor. This creates a dynamic yet balanced look.
